Fox hosts take a stand against vaccine mandates – but not Fox's own vaccine mandate

Written by Jane Lee

Published 10/21/21 9:15 AM EDT

On the October 20 edition of Fox News Primetime, Fox News host Dan Bongino discussed an ultimatum he’d given his employer Cumulus Radio over its vaccine mandate.  Bongino had railed against Cumulus a few days before, threatening,  “Cumulus is going to have to make a decision with me if they want to continue this partnership or they don't.”

But Bongino neglected to mention Fox News, where he hosts a show on Saturday evenings, in either rant. Fox Corp. has implemented vaccine and testing requirements that go beyond the Biden administration’s policies; the company requires proof of vaccination or daily testing. Yet Bongino conspicuously ignored the network in his rants.

Following the interview, fellow Fox host and vaccine mandate detractor Tucker Carlson came on the show and complimented the Bongino segment, calling it “so inspiring.

Carlson’s comments follow his own campaign against vaccine and testing requirements and corresponding refusal to address the same policies at Fox Corp.
